Meet Justice - Virtue Litter

Meet Justice! Born 12/27/24 this half-beagle cutie is on the hunt to find his furever family!   Justice is the most sensitive of his siblings...he's the big sweetie but he's also the 'baby' who needs a little extra reassurance.  Jump off that step? Maybe after he sees his brothers and sisters do it and survive...and always in his own time. But that doesn't mean he's not ready to play and find just as much trouble as his siblings. He's cautious, sweet, gives kisses and loves to play with his siblings. Valor's mom is a small beagle (18 lbs), puppy growth charts estimate his adult size about 25lbs give or take.   Please remember pups looks and personalities can change quite a bit as they grow up. They lose their puppy coats and growth estimates are notoriously unreliable when dealing with mixed breeds.   Also note that puppies are LOTS of work. They cannot be alone for 8 hours a day, they chew EVERYTHING, they are physically not capable of 'holding' it for long periods until they mature and they're top skill is usually finding trouble no matter how well you think you've puppy-proofed your home. Given Justice's personality we think he'd do well with a family who has the time and patience to work with a puppy, especially one who's might take some extra encouragement for new experiences. Since Justice is half beagle, he is probably not the best fit for a shared wall. He could be very vocal as an adult.    Justice will be ready to go home by mid April.
